I have also been making pot holder flat iron cases for friends and sold some too!  They are loving these things and super easy to make.  I have to mention I love sewing things together that come together very quickly too and usable!  You can use these for your flat iron OR you can also use them for your curling iron BUT you can't sew all the way up the side for the curling irons because they do have that trigger handle so you have to stop a little above mid point on sewing those to leave room for that.  They work great and safe and heat resistant because they are actually pot holders that are folded in half and then sewn.  Such a cute idea whoever come up with the idea.  I found several people who have done this on the internet so not sure who to give the credit to for the idea but they are genious!
